如何解决 SQL Server Management Studio (SSMS) 丢失的问题

在日常的数据库管理和开发工作中,SQL Server Management Studio (SSMS) 是一个非常重要的工具。然而,有时因为各种原因,SSMS 可能会消失或未能启动。本文将指导你如何一步一步地找回 SSMS,通过简单的步骤和代码示例,让新手能快速掌握技巧。

解决流程概述

在处理 SSMS 丢失的问题时,通常需要进行以下几个步骤:

步骤 内容 说明
1 检查 SSMS 是否安装 确保系统中已安装 SSMS
2 修复 SSMS 如果文件损坏,可以尝试修复
3 卸载并重装SSMS 若仍无法解决,考虑重装 SSMS
4 使用脚本连接数据库 使用命令行工具连接数据库以验证

下面我们将详细介绍每一步需要做什么。

步骤详解

步骤 1:检查 SSMS 是否安装

首先,我们需要确认 SSMS 是否被正确安装。在 Windows 中,你可以通过以下步骤来检查:

  1. 打开“开始”菜单。
  2. 输入 “SQL Server Management Studio” 在搜索框中。
  3. 如果找到应用程序,则说明已安装。

如果没有找到,它可能未安装或已被卸载。

步骤 2:修复 SSMS

如果 SSMS 已安装,但无法启动,我们可以尝试修复它。请按照以下步骤操作:

  1. 打开“控制面板”。
  2. 选择“程序和功能”。
  3. 找到 “Microsoft SQL Server Management Studio”。
  4. 右键点击,选择“修复”。

这将会重新安装必要的文件,修复一些常见问题。

步骤 3:卸载并重装 SSMS

如果修复没有效果,你可以选择卸载并重新安装 SSMS。这是一个比较彻底的方式。

  1. 同样进入“程序和功能”。
  2. 在列表中找到“Microsoft SQL Server Management Studio”。
  3. 右键选择“卸载”。
  4. 访问 [Microsoft 官网]( 下载最新版本的 SSMS。
  5. 按照提示安装。

步骤 4:使用脚本连接数据库

如果 SSMS 依然无法使用,你可以通过 SQL Server 的命令行工具(SQLCMD)连接数据库,确认数据库服务的正常性。

SQLCMD 安装与使用

首先,确保你已经安装了 SQL Server 管理工具包或使用的是命令行界面(CLI)。

  1. 打开命令提示符(CMD)。
  2. 输入以下命令连接到 SQL Server 实例:
sqlcmd -S <服务器名称> -U <用户名> -P <密码>
  • -S 后跟服务器名称或 IP 地址
  • -U 后跟你的数据库用户名
  • -P 后跟你的密码

实际示例

假设服务器名称为 localhost,用户名为 sa,密码为 password123,则命令如下:

sqlcmd -S localhost -U sa -P password123

这条命令将连接到本地的 SQL Server,并使用 sa 用户进行身份验证。如果成功,你将看到一个类似于以下的提示符:

1>

你就成功连接了 SQL Server,可以输入 SQL 查询来验证功能。

结构化的流程图

通过上述步骤,我们可以形成一个结构化的流程图,帮助理解解决问题的流程。请看下面的 mermaid 流程图:

flowchart TD
    A[检查 SSMS 是否安装] -->|是| B[修复 SSMS]
    A -->|否| C[卸载并重装 SSMS]
    B --> D{是否修复成功}
    D -->|是| E[继续正常使用]
    D -->|否| C
    C --> F[使用命令行连接数据库]
    F --> G{数据库是否正常工作}
    G -->|是| H[等待 SSMS 问题修复]
    G -->|否| I[检查数据库状态]

结论

通过以上步骤,你应该能找回 SQL Server Management Studio 或至少确保数据库服务在正常运行。无论是通过修复、重装还是命令行连接,掌握基本的处理方式都将极大提高你在数据库开发和管理中的效率。希望这些简单的步骤能够对你有所帮助,让你在数据库管理的道路上走得更加顺利。如果你还有其他问题,可以继续跟进相关文档或询问有经验的前辈。